A big question for -Odebug is e.g. if we should enable var-tracking for it or
not. While it is time consuming, it should improve the debug experience, there
are various cases where -O -g is actually better debuggable than -O0 -g which
doesn't do var-tracking, e.g. with register vars, or VLAs, or during
prologues/epilogues.
